As a(n) [position title] within PNC's Without Detection & Investigation organization, you will be based in Louisville, KY.

This role is for an analyst who reviews and processes incoming and outgoing check fraud claims on behalf of PNC customers, other financial institutions and the US Treasury pertaining to endorsement and altered check issues. The analyst is responsible for validating check fraud incidents by gathering, maintaining, and storing related case documentation, reviewing customer transactions to prevent and mitigate risks of fraudulent activity in addition to obtaining claim resolution.

This may require direct contact with customers, internal bank service partners, legal, as well as interaction with external associates such as other banks and law enforcement agencies. Additional duties include the timely reporting of suspicious activity to the appropriate personnel.
